Hi, my name is Wendy Brill, and I am reaching out on behalf of my son, Elijah Barela. On the morning of September 23, 2025, Elijah was on his way to work when the accident happened. He was riding his Kawasaki Ninja motorcycle, heading to the job he loves as a mechanic. Elijah has been with his current workplace for two years, but his passion and skill for fixing and building run deep — he has been a mechanic for more than nine years.

As he was going through a green light, another vehicle suddenly pulled out in front of him. Elijah had no chance to avoid the collision. He was rushed by ambulance to Memorial Centre Hospital, where he underwent CT scans, x-rays, and additional imaging. His injuries include severe bruising, painful road rash, and issues with his hip that now leave him walking with a cane.

Elijah’s greatest pride and joy are his two small children, who live with him in his apartment. He is doing everything he can to stay strong for them, but recovery is slow, and the medical bills, therapy costs, and everyday expenses are piling up. While Elijah continues to fight through the pain, the financial stress is making a difficult situation even harder.

Elijah is a hardworking father, a loyal friend, and someone who would give the shirt off his back to help others. Now he’s the one in need.
